Empyrean Sanctum – the project headed up by Justin Kellerman – is set to release their new record Detachment From Reality on April 18. We’re streaming the new single “Descent” alongside a new video directed by Alex Zarek.
“Descent deals with depression, being stagnant, lacking purpose, and feeling completely broken with a yearning to feel whole again,” said Kellerman of the track. “Many of us have experienced this or are currently. This song is a reminder that you are not alone, and to reach deep within and love yourself.”

Detachment From Reality features drummer Hannes Grossmann (Alkaloid, Triptykon, Eternity’s End, ex-Obscura, ex-Necrophagist) and bassist Alex Weber (Revocation, Exist, ex-Obscura), plus guest appearances from Per Nilsson (Scar Symmetry, ex-Meshuggah) and Gabriel Riccio (The Gabriel Construct).
